Output ecb873d1e6bfda3847d0491a6f9e05f80f5f6eebf637e7cda1b8e32ae2e9fc3c:0

value
43844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65786832005c3ae9c59668abebca5fe5d0dc199c OP_EQUAL
address
3AwYQwjjHPbzzfLFXUt6hT5XuEs7fMCjVu
transaction
ecb873d1e6bfda3847d0491a6f9e05f80f5f6eebf637e7cda1b8e32ae2e9fc3c
confirmations
170703
spent
true